So this post about the infamous "survey" hit the ME reddit:

quote:
NARRATIVE:
Premise: Set in the Helius Cluster of the Andromeda Galaxy, removed by time and space from the Mass Effect "Commander Shepard" trilogy and its ending. Play as a "Pathfinder" explorer leading expedition with the aim of establishing new home for humanity. Encounter "savage untamed lands", "cut-throat outlaws", and "warring alien races" in an effort to survive and colonies. Andromeda is home to a mysterious alien race, the Remnants, who've left their vaults and ancient technology throughout.
Game Objective: Explore 100s of solar systems (over 4x size of Mass Effect 3) collecting resources, developing your ship, crew, and arsenal, while engaging in diplomacy in order to set up colonies, while discovering the mystery behind the Remnants and racing to secure their technology.
New Species: Remnants, an ancient race who've left ruins and technology throughout the galaxy. And Khet, seemingly antagonistic.
Squadmates: Same as previous games: make friends, take two with you on missions. Cora is able to generate biotic shields you can fire out of. Drack is a Krogan.
Loyalty Missions: Same as previous games: complete to unlock increased loyalty and new skill tree for that character. Example: Krogan colony ship has been stolen by outlaws. Track down the ship and return it to increase loyalty with Drack. Dialogue trees and end game impacted by loyalty status.
Dialogue: "Meaningful choices". Deeper control over responses, such as interrupting conversation. Action based choices are physical choices to shape the course of conversation, such as pulling out a weapon and forcing them to open a door instead of attempting to do so purely via conversation.

EXPLORATION/CUSTOMISATION
Tempest Starship: Pilotable ship to discover 100s of solar systems. Customisable with trophies/loot/photos taken through the galaxy. Transition between flying ship, to landing on planet, to driving Mako, to getting out on foot, all seamless with no loading screens.
Mako Vehicle: Upgradeable with turbo boost, shield generator, hostile detector, etc. Customisable paint job.
Planets: 100s of surfaces to explore, for discovering places to colonise, and alien vaults/outputs to conquer.
Colonies: Build settlements on habitable planets. Able to decide what type of settlement for bonuses. EG: Recon Settlements will clear fog of war on space map and offer more strike team missions, meanwhile Mining Settlements will periodically supply crafting materials.
Blueprints: Allow you to craft alien technology using materials for better equipment and weapons, such as a jetpack for jumping, cryo-beam to target enemies, etc.
Crew: Customisable skill trees, gear, weapons, etc.

MISSIONS TYPES AND MULTIPLAYER:
Remnant Vault Raids: Ancient ruins in two variants. Standard: Accessed by finding and activating Remnant Monoliths, explored to find a "powerful artefact". Acquiring artefact triggers defence systems: robots, traps, and restructured layout. Rewards with valuable loot, crafting resources, and Star Keys. Orbital Facilities: Unlocked with Star Keys, provide permanent stat bonuses, and optional higher difficulty vault raids that add Khet patrols and outlaws. Rewards with rare loot and narrative acclaim.
Khet Outposts: Optional wave-based combat challenges that reward with XP, reduced Khet power and additional narrative options in the region if destroyed.
Strike Team: Spend resources to recruit mercenaries and develop AI controlled strike teams to be deployed on randomly generated, time sensitive missions. Include settlement defence and remnant artefact recovery. Strike Teams return 20 - 30 minutes later with XP, currency, and equipment depending on mission outcome. Spend money/resources to train Strike Team, and buy better equipment, to increase success rate and send on dangerous missions.
Active Strike Team: See above, however you can choose to complete the Strike Team mission manually via play using your multiplayer roster of characters. Able to play co-op with friends, more friends increasing difficulty and rewards. Bonus rewards for joining another players strike team mission. XP, loot, and customisation rewards for Strike Team played characters are cohesive with multiplayer specific horde mode.
Horde Mode: Similar to Mass Effect 3: four players against waves of enemies with additional objectives such as disabling a bomb or assassinating a target. Similar XP/loot rewards to Mass Effect 3. APEX funds earned to be used in single player.

I'm not for it being more "open-world." We had that with Mass Effect 1, and there was just entirely too much space to search with too much time spent driving in whatever that little vehicle is. I don't want more exploring landscapes and a less defined story.

What I want is Mass Effect 2 and 3, but even bigger. A focused story with a lot more campaign missions, a lot more meaningful choices, more weapons and upgrades of course. But mainly I want a lot more populated hubs (like the citadel) with lots of different stores, lots of different people to talk to with conversations that further develop the story, and definitely a lot more side quests (that still tie into the main story as they do so well in Mass Effect).

I don't want just hours of aimless exploring like in ME1, and I doubt that's what they're going for. I think they learned with 2 and 3 that these games are so much better when everything you do has a story-driven purpose, even if it's not immediate or obvious.

A few quick observations:

1) The planets shown and the speed of the Mako seem to suggest that this won't be the same kind of "exploration" as we saw in ME1. ME1 was practically all moons, and you roamed around at a slow speed with 1 cannon and 1 machine gun. This is a customizable Mako, and (I'd imagine) worlds that are far more interesting and enticing than moon 1, moon 2, moon 3, etc.

2) 2007 was a long time ago in gaming. They've learned a few things since then.

3) Setting this game in a new galaxy is the only way to avoid retconning the Crucible decision from ME3. There's no forced canon if the Ark (or whatever you want to call it) left before the finale of ME3. Now, HOW they got to Andromeda is a complete unknown.

4) As much as I love the original trilogy, I think it's a good thing if there are no cameos, or Reapers. Take the old races with you, but open the door to all kinds of new possibilities.

5) The original survey link mentions strategically establishing settlements. I doubt each of these settlements will be hub worlds, but my guess is that there would be some kind of central launching point. Your ship (the Tempest, apparently) is just one ship in Andromeda. Survey mentions, for example, a Krogan colony ship.

6) Glad that the Krogan will be joining, but how will they resolve the Geno****e decision? Not every Shepard cured it.

7) Slight concern about an N7 soldier rocket-punching an enemy through a hail of bullets.

The Mass Effect series is what opened the entire RPG genre to me. Before I played Mass Effect, I thought all RPGs were like Final Fantasy. I've likely played more hours of ME3 multiplayer than any non-MMO (Turian Soldier with proxy mines FTW). Here's what I know about Andromeda:

  • Scheduled to release Q4 of 2016.
  • During the reveal of the "Andromeda" title, they stated their goal was to mesh the action play of ME3 with the openness of the original ME.
  • A large aspect of the game is going to be exploring/fighting in the new Mako, which is going to be upgradeable/customizable as you advance your story.
  • They suggested early on that the protagonist isn't required to be human, but I don't know if they have officially stated one way or the other yet.

Regarding the open issues created by ME3, first off I don't see why the end has to be a big deal. The only major difference between the 3 choices is whether the Geth survived. If you remember, the very end is an old man telling his grandson about "the Sheppard." So we know Earth and humanity survived. The major catastrophe is the destruction of the mass relay system, but the game had already indicated that people were figuring out how to create new mass relays. With all three choices, the Reaper threat goes away, because presumably "the Sheppard" now controls them and wouldn't use them to renew the life cycle any longer. IMO the important thing about the Geno****e isn't whether you cured it or not in your play through, but the fact that a cure exists. In any future games, they can easily write around that choice. Ex: Krogans were "cured" but their reproduction cycle is no longer as rapid as pre-Geno****e, or that Krogan have evolved to have a normalized reproduction cycle.
